Question
The objective of ASEAN is not restricted only to accelerating economic growth. Explain the statement.
Advertisements
Solution
ASEAN, or the Association of Southeast Asian Nations, was established to increase cooperation among Southeast Asian nations in a variety of fields:
- This body plans to collaborate in areas such as the economy, cultural integration, travel ease, tourism growth, and many other areas.
- One of the most important areas of collaboration is in the field of border and maritime security.

Read the following passage carefully and answer the question.
| ASEAN was and still remains principally an economic association. While the ASEAN region as a whole is a much smaller economy compared to the US the EU, and Japan, its economy is growing much faster than all these. This accounts for the growth in its influence both in the region and beyond. The objectives of the ASEAN Economic Community are to create a common market and production base within the ASEAN States and to aid social and economic development in the region. The Economic Community would also like to improve the existing ASEAN Dispute Settlement Mechanism to resolve economic disputes. ASEAN has focused on creating a Free Trade Area (FTA) for investment, labour, and services. The US and China have already moved fast to negotiate FTAs with ASEAN. |
